Publisher Description

Dave Vander Meer was just eighteen years old when he set out on his own to explore the northern wilderness of Ontario. Winter would start in just a week, and there was a camp to build, traps to set, and food and furs to collect. To survive, he needed to call upon all his knowledge because the closest point of civilization was more than twenty miles away.

Now, years later, he still looks back upon his time as a teenager in the woods with wonder. He had the chance to walk the trails and paddle the lakes as he experienced the excitement of eluding several brushes with death.

Jump into a dream and experience the beauty, danger, and excitement that a trapper enjoys during his daily routines in The Call of the Wilderness.

If you love the outdoors, you'll love this book, plain and simple. The author, inspired by the true life adventures of the Vanderbeck family (as chronicled by Stephen Meader, in his wonderful book, Traplines North), embarks on his own solitary adventure in the Canadian Northwoods. Luckily for armchair adventurers (like me) he provides us with a wonderful, first hand account of that magical time in his life. It's truly a bargain, so light the fire, and follow his snow shoe tracks from the comfort of your favorite chair.
